WebHamlet's originally acts mad (crazy, not angry) to fool people into think he is harmless while probing his father's death and Claudius 's involvement. Early on, the bumbling Polonius says " [t]hough this be madness, yet there is method in't" (Act II, Scene II). Polonius's assertion is ironic because he is right and wrong.
